#a0503e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a0503e is composed of 62.7% red, 31.4%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 11 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#a0503e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a07c with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#a0503e color description : Dark moderate red.
#a0503e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a0503e has RGB values of R:160, G:80,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.61,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10506302.

Shades and Tints of #a0503e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0503e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756b69 is the less saturated color, while #dc2a02 is the most saturated one.
